Here are some resources related to trade aid fortnight in May 2008 (but are applicable beyond that). A sample plan on toys is attached as a file.
Around the 2008 theme for Fair Trade Fortnight, Environmental Justice, Trade Aid NZ have developed a number of resources with help from teachers of various age levels. These resources are new and will be useful to teachers who have an interest in teaching global topics. They fit perfectly within the new teaching curriculum, focussing on developing several key competencies.
Many schools already have a focus on the environment or sustainability and using the theme Environmental Justice will add a new and interesting angle to these very important subject areas.
We have developed these resources in the context of our Fair Trade Fortnight programme to enable schools to join in, but environmental justice and sustainability are of course themes with a long term focus. Therefore these resources will also be useful in years to come, and we will update them, based on feedback we get from teachers, to further improve our support to classroom activities in schools.
Schools programme - a pre-school programme and teaching units
suitable for levels 1 - 5 social studies looking at subjects such as
'where my toys come from' and 'what is their impact' and researching the
different impacts of environmental degradation on rich and poor
communities. Incorporating climate change and our carbon footprints.
